全球智能桿市场预计将从2021年的71亿美元增长到2031年的359亿美元,2022年至2031年的复合年增长率为17.9%。

Smart Poles Market-IMG1

SmartPole 是一种先进的互联路灯系统,它使用传感器、摄像头和通信系统来提高传统路灯的功能和效率。这些电线桿可以与物联网 (IoT) 集成,提供有关交通流量、空气质量、天气状况等的实时数据和信息。智能桿旨在支持智慧城市计划并提高公共安全、能源效率和可持续性。

随着物联网设备和5G网络的兴起,智能桿可以提供无线连接并支持智能照明、交通管理、环境监测、公共安全和多媒体服务等广泛应用,从而增加了对智能桿的需求.它正在上升。Smart Pole 配备 Wi-Fi、LTE、Zigbee 和蓝牙等先进技术,可为智能手机、笔记本电脑和物联网传感器等各种设备提供无缝连接。随着越来越多的设备联网,对可靠、快速无线连接的需求不断增加,使智能桿成为智能城市基础设施的关键组成部分。因此,未来几年对智能桿的需求预计将进一步增长。随着世界各地的城市寻求升级其基础设施以满足不断增长的无线连接需求,智能桿市场规模预计将在预测期内扩大。

智能桿是一项相对较新的技术,我们生产这些产品的製造能力有限。这限制了大规模部署的可扩展性,并使城市难以采用该技术。此外,随着智能桿变得越来越流行,需要有明确的限制和法规,以确保收集到的数据得到道德和负责任的处理。缺乏监管可能会导致数据滥用并阻碍智能桿在某些地区的采用。将智能桿纳入现有基础设施的复杂性也给可扩展性带来了挑战。缺乏行业标准化使得市政当局难以经济高效地购买和安装智能桿。

对可再生能源的日益关注以及对高效能源管理系统的需求不断增加也推动了智能桿市场的增长。将太阳能电池板和电池存储纳入智能桿可以增加额外的清洁能源来源并减少对并网电力的依赖。智能桿还提供其他好处,例如提高安全性、改善交通流量和实时数据收集。通过集成传感器、摄像头和 Wi-Fi 等其他技术,智能桿成为智能城市基础设施解决方案。智能桿市场具有巨大的增长潜力,能够有效解决成本、耐用性和维护挑战的公司能够很好地抓住这一市场机会。

COVID-19 大流行带来了许多不确定性,导致世界各地的各种企业陷入停顿,导致严重的财务损失。COVID-19疫情对智能桿市场产生了重大影响。由于政府广泛的封锁和旅行限制,许多处于规划和实施阶段的智能桿项目被搁置。这导致市场增长放缓和行业收入下降。智能桿的製造和安装受到供应链中断以及疫情造成的需求减少的影响。

The global smart poles market is anticipated to reach $35.9 billion by 2031, growing from $7.1 billion in 2021 at a CAGR of 17.9% from 2022 to 2031.

Smart poles are advanced and connected street lighting systems that use sensors, cameras, and communication systems to enhance the functionality and efficiency of traditional street lighting. These poles can be integrated with the Internet of Things (IoT) to provide real-time data and information on traffic flow, air quality, weather conditions, and others. Smart poles are designed to support smart city initiatives and improve public safety, energy efficiency, and sustainability.

The rise of IoT devices and 5G networks is driving the demand for smart poles, as they can provide wireless connectivity and support a wide range of applications such as smart lighting, traffic management, environmental monitoring, public safety and security, and multimedia services. Smart poles are equipped with advanced technologies such as Wi-Fi, LTE, Zigbee, and Bluetooth that provide seamless connectivity to a variety of devices, including smartphones, laptops, and IoT sensors. As more devices become connected, the need for reliable and fast wireless connectivity is increasing, making smart poles a critical component of smart city infrastructure. This is expected to further drive the demand for smart poles in the upcoming years. As cities around the world look to upgrade their infrastructure to meet the growing demand for wireless connectivity, the smart poles market size is anticipated to boost during the forecast period.

Smart poles are a relatively new technology and there is limited manufacturing capacity for producing these products. This results in limited scalability for large-scale deployment, making it difficult for cities to adopt the technology. In addition, as smart poles become more widespread, clear limitations and regulations need to be established to ensure that the collected data is handled ethically and responsibly. A lack of regulations can lead to data misuse and hamper the deployment of smart poles in some regions. The complexity of integrating smart poles into existing infrastructure also presents a challenge for scalability. The lack of standardization in the industry makes it difficult for municipal corporations to purchase and install smart poles cost-effectively and efficiently.

The increase in focus on renewable energy sources, and the need for efficient energy management systems, are also driving the growth of the smart poles market. The integration of solar panels and battery storage in smart poles provides an additional source of clean energy and reduces the reliance on grid-connected electricity. Smart poles also offer additional benefits such as increased safety and security, improved traffic flow, and real-time data collection. The integration of other technologies such as sensors, cameras, and Wi-Fi, makes smart poles a smart city infrastructure solution. The smart poles market offers significant growth potential, and companies that can effectively address the challenges of cost, durability, and maintenance are well-positioned to capture this opportunity in the market.

The COVID-19 pandemic brought several uncertainties leading to severe economic losses as various businesses across the world were at a standstill. The COVID-19 pandemic has had a significant impact on the smart poles market. Many smart pole projects that were in the planning and implementation stages were put on hold due to the widespread lockdowns and travel restrictions imposed by governments. This has led to a slowdown in the growth of the market and a decline in revenue for the industry. The manufacturing and installation of smart poles have been impacted by supply chain disruptions, as well as reduced demand due to the pandemic.
